Spatial Information Demystified: Exploring the Concept and its Implications

Spatial information refers to data that has a geographic reference or location component. It provides valuable insights into how the world works and enables organizations to make informed decisions. Unlike traditional data, spatial data captures the interaction between objects and the environment, which cannot be effectively analyzed by other means. It is crucial for governments, businesses, and individuals to understand this concept and its implications.

The Importance of Spatial Information

Spatial information has rapidly become mainstream and is utilized in multiple fields, including health and human services, real estate, urban planning, emergency response, transportation, and logistics. It helps organizations to manage their assets and make more informed decisions that reflect customer needs, environmental factors, and social aspects.

For instance, a real estate firm can use spatial information to identify the most suitable location for a new development. By analyzing data on demographics, traffic flow, land uses, and zoning, they can estimate the demand for properties in the area and design the development to meet those needs. This approach reduces the risk of building in unsuitable locations and helps the firm achieve better returns on their investment.

Spatial information is also essential in the transportation industry. By monitoring traffic patterns, public transport systems can adjust their routes and schedules to optimize efficiency and reduce the time commuters spend travelling. Accurate spatial data also enables transportation companies to manage their fleets more effectively by identifying the best routes to take and anticipating potential issues such as road closures or construction sites.

The Applications of Spatial Information

The applications of spatial information are numerous, and they vary across different sectors. In the education sector, schools can use spatial data to identify areas with high levels of literacy and provide targeted support to students in other areas. Health organizations can use spatial data to track the spread of infectious diseases and establish appropriate quarantines. Spatial information is also used by sports organizations to plan routes for marathons and other endurance events.

The use of spatial information is not limited to the private sector. Government agencies use spatial data to monitor land use, track air pollution levels, and manage wildlife habitats. By integrating spatial data into their decision-making process, governments can manage resources more effectively, respond more quickly to emergencies, and make better decisions about infrastructure development.
